Transaction 4df95659eb11911a29347536b2f61c5b2508e995451787d33401e8ff53a9fa05
1 Input
2 Outputs
- 4df95659eb11911a29347536b2f61c5b2508e995451787d33401e8ff53a9fa05:0
- 4df95659eb11911a29347536b2f61c5b2508e995451787d33401e8ff53a9fa05:1
value 703403
address 3CkA9WbnScZCCeGaRwnBeZqY4FSAR25Pox
value 34258293
address 1KWB8Ern667Zn18ofuWTdzMf6FqVErC3fP